How to Notice When You Need a Roof Expert?
In what ways can a property owner recognize the ideal time to call a roof contractor? Detecting the red flags of roof deterioration is paramount for upkeeping a safe and reliable home. Residents should stay conscious of loose, cracked, or curling shingles, which reveal likely damage. Furthermore, the presence of water stains on upper surfaces or walls may suggest water damage that require immediate attention. A declining roof profile is yet another considerable warning sign, typically pointing to structural issues in the underlying structure.
Additionally, higher energy costs can suggest insufficient thermal protection or faulty air circulation caused by roofing issues. Routine assessments after harsh weather conditions such as storms or heavy snowfall are crucial to identify any emerging problems promptly. If any of these red flags are observed, it is advisable to contact a qualified roofing contractor to assess the situation and recommend necessary fixes or replacements. Timely action can prevent additional damage and guarantee the longevity of the roof.

Asphalt Shingles Summary
Numerous homeowners opt for asphalt shingles due to their balance of cost-effectiveness and longevity. These shingles, constructed primarily of asphalt and fiberglass, deliver a versatile roofing solution. They come in a selection of styles and colors, allowing homeowners to customize their roofs to match their aesthetic preferences. The mean lifespan of asphalt shingles ranges from 15 to 30 years, depending on the quality and installation. Additionally, they perform admirably in various weather conditions, enduring wind and rain effectively. Maintenance is relatively straightforward, often requiring only periodic inspections and cleaning. As a widely used roofing material, asphalt shingles also provide good fire resistance, contributing to their appeal among homeowners seeking trustworthy and cost-effective roofing options.
Metal Roofing Positives
While many property owners desire longevity in roof options, metal roofing excels as an exceptional choice. Recognized for its impressive longevity, metal roofs can last 40 to 70 years, considerably outpacing traditional options like asphalt shingles. They are resistant to a variety of we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and wind, making them ideal for diverse climates. Additionally, metal roofing bounces back solar heat, enhancing energy efficiency and lowering cooling costs. Its light nature allows for simpler installation and less structural strain. Offered in a variety of styles and colors, metal roofs also enhance a home's aesthetic appeal. With reduced maintenance requirements, metal roofing proves to be a smart investment for homeowners prioritizing durability and sustainability.
Tile Durability Insights
Tile roofing provides another durable option for homeowners looking for enduring solutions. Recognized for its resilience, tile roofing can withstand harsh weather circumstances, such as intense sunlight, substantial rain, and powerful winds. Concrete and clay tiles are the widely popular types, each providing unique benefits. Clay tiles are fire-resistant and can last over 100 years, while concrete tiles provide affordability and flexibility in design. Both types require little maintenance and are immune to rot and insects. Furthermore, tile roofing contributes to energy efficiency by reflecting sunlight, reducing cooling costs. Nevertheless, it is essential to examine the weight of tile roofing, as it may demand extra structural support. Overall, tile roofing remains a wise choice for longevity and longevity.
Analyzing Roofing Services: Important Quality Benchmarks
When evaluating the quality of roofing work, several key markers emerge that can greatly influence a project's longevity and performance. First, the materials used must meet industry standards; superior materials guarantee durability and withstand environmental stressors. Second, the installation method is vital; improper installation can lead to leaks and structural issues, regardless of material quality. Third, meticulous attention in flashing and sealing can prevent water intrusion, a common cause of damage.
Additionally, the availability of proper ventilation is essential, as it aids in managing heat levels and dampness within the roof assembly. Finally, an established contractor will provide coverage for both materials and construction quality, showing confidence in their services. By evaluating these indicators, property owners can make sound determinations about the quality of roofing work and its impact on their asset.

How much time Does a Typical Roofing Project Take to Finish?
A typical roofing project usually takes around one to three weeks to complete. Elements affecting the timeline include roof dimensions, materials used, weather conditions, and the intricacy of the installation process.
What Coverage Do Roofing Contractors Usually Provide on Their Work?
Roofing contractors typically offer guarantees spanning 5 to 30 years, based on the materials used and the intricacy of the project. These warranties often cover defects in workmanship and materials, ensuring long-term protection for clients.
